Output 58a3e0aa9d64e83765274ddc1947eac8e0de2f658760a82a8e13d79f7ff7df8a:0

value
3525867002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612d978debf1908c1c7a211da08a9bf231179810 OP_EQUAL
address
3AYr5wTDrNRjuVPZWSxUNsaxP92vDmkTP8
transaction
58a3e0aa9d64e83765274ddc1947eac8e0de2f658760a82a8e13d79f7ff7df8a
confirmations
550872
spent
true